Transaction 33d4b6b76150161497ef5b00d6b4e45b65e667fa94f42a6fdaa8492cfca2e0f4
2 Input
2 Outputs
- 33d4b6b76150161497ef5b00d6b4e45b65e667fa94f42a6fdaa8492cfca2e0f4:0
- 33d4b6b76150161497ef5b00d6b4e45b65e667fa94f42a6fdaa8492cfca2e0f4:1
value 150000
address 1HFerXgEknQsbDbodgukZWgYV2gE7yieXy
value 21422086
address 168ntM2aC2xZkuJiE4iYigpnkfWR96r827